随着互联网应用全球化程度的加深,内容分发网络已成为网站和应用的必备基础设施。通过将内容缓存至离用户最近的边缘节点,CDN能显著提升访问速度、降低源站压力,并增强安全性。根据实测数据,部署CDN服务可使页面加载速度提升40%-60%,同时有效改善用户留存率和转化率。 在面对市场上数十家服务商时,科学的选型方法和清晰的配置流程显得尤为重要。

CDN的核心技术架构
现代CDN系统采用分层架构设计,主要包括边缘节点层、智能调度层、协议优化层和安全防护层四大核心组件。 边缘节点层由全球部署的2000+节点构成覆盖六大洲的加速网络,通过BGP Anycast技术实现最优路径选择。某电商平台在东南亚部署边缘节点后,当地用户访问延迟从3.2秒降至0.8秒即是明证。 智能调度层依托实时网络质量监测的GSLB系统,每5秒更新节点健康状态,在节点拥塞时自动切换流量,确保99.9%的请求成功率。
动态内容加速能力是现代CDN区别于传统架构的关键特性。通过TCP/UDP优化算法、QUIC协议支持和智能路由技术,CDN可将动态内容传输效率提升30%以上。 某金融平台实测数据显示,启用动态加速后API响应时间从320ms降至145ms,错误率下降67%。 安全防护层则提供DDoS防护和CC攻击防御等模块,成功案例包括某金融网站抵御400Gbps流量攻击。
关键性能评估指标
选择CDN服务时,需重点关注以下性能指标:
- 节点覆盖质量:优质CDN应具备全球覆盖能力,特别针对目标用户所在地区进行重点部署。骨干节点需直连Tier1运营商,边缘节点应下沉至二三线城市,并支持多运营商接入。
- 缓存命中率:通过curl -I命令测试X-Cache-Hit字段,连续测试10次以上,命中率应高于95%。
- 动态加速效果:考察服务商是否支持HTTP/2、HTTP/3等多路复用技术,这些技术可将首屏加载时间从2.3秒缩短至0.9秒。
测试工具推荐使用WebPageTest统计静态资源占比,Chrome DevTools识别动态请求。建议将大于100KB的资源纳入CDN缓存,同时对API请求和表单提交等动态内容进行回源处理。
主流服务商对比分析
根据2025年最新市场数据,国内CDN服务商可分为两大梯队:
| 服务商 | 市场份额 | 节点数量 | 适用场景 | 价格起点 |
|---|---|---|---|---|
| 阿里云CDN | 30.6% | 1500+全球节点 | 中大型企业、电商平台 | 0.24元/GB |
| 腾讯云CDN | 10.4% | 2800+加速节点 | 视频直播、游戏社交 | 10GB免费额度 |
| 百度云CDN | – | – | 重视SEO的网站 | – |
阿里云CDN作为市场领导者,技术最为成熟,节点资源丰富,特别适合业务稳定增长的企业级客户。 腾讯云CDN则在视频直播优化和微信生态整合方面具有独特优势,其每月提供的10GB免费额度对初创项目友好。 百度云CDN凭借AI智能调度和搜索引擎优化能力,在SEO敏感型应用中表现突出。
成本优化策略
CDN成本控制需从多个维度着手:
- 流量计费模式:主流服务商均采用按流量计费,月度预算应包含突发流量缓冲
- 缓存策略优化:合理设置资源过期时间,静态资源建议缓存30天,动态内容根据业务需求调整
- 回源配置:设置回源超时时间为5秒,重试次数不超过3次,避免因回源问题导致服务不可用
对于预算敏感的中小型项目,可优先考虑提供免费额度的服务商。例如多吉云提供20GB/月CDN流量、200万次/月HTTPS请求包和10GB存储包,完全能满足日IP100左右站点的需求。
安全防护配置要点
CDN安全配置不仅关乎服务稳定性,更直接影响到企业的数据资产安全。建议从访问控制、流量管理和证书管理三个层面构建防护体系。
具体配置包括:启用域名防盗链白名单机制,配置IP黑白名单和UA过滤规则,设置QPS限制为10次/秒起,并配置5分钟内流量到达100M的封顶限制。 单链接限速建议设置为512KB/秒,既能保证用户体验,又可有效防止资源盗用。
实施部署流程详解
CDN部署可分为三个标准化阶段:
- 资源评估与规划:使用分析工具识别静态资源占比,规划节点部署位置
- DNS配置:通过CNAME记录将cdn.example.com指向服务商提供的域名
- 缓存策略实施:区分静态与动态内容,制定差异化缓存规则
以阿里云CDN配置为例,首先登录控制台添加域名,配置CNAME解析记录,然后设置回源策略和HTTPS证书。 证书可采用Let’s Encrypt免费证书或商业证书,需配置SNI支持多域名。
监控与持续优化
CDN服务上线后需建立常态化监控机制:
- 性能指标跟踪:持续监测加载时间、首屏渲染速度等关键指标
- 安全事件响应:建立流量异常告警机制,设置防刷阈值
- 成本分析:定期审查用量报告,优化资源配置
部署完成后,建议通过全链路测试验证加速效果,重点检查不同地区、不同运营商用户的访问体验。同时建议配置监控告警,当缓存命中率低于90%或错误率超过1%时及时介入调整。
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/62329.html